Cirrus Logic Cash on Hand 2010-2025 | CRUS

Cirrus Logic cash on hand from 2010 to 2025. Cash on hand can be defined as cash deposits at financial institutions that can immediately be withdrawn at any time, and investments maturing in one year or less that are highly liquid and therefore regarded as cash equivalents and reported with or near cash line items.
  • Cirrus Logic cash on hand for the quarter ending June 30, 2025 was $0.615B, a 18.91% increase year-over-year.
  • Cirrus Logic cash on hand for 2025 was $0.596B, a 13.15% increase from 2024.
  • Cirrus Logic cash on hand for 2024 was $0.527B, a 9.52% increase from 2023.
  • Cirrus Logic cash on hand for 2023 was $0.481B, a 26.38% increase from 2022.

Cirrus Logic is a fabless semiconductor supplier, which develops, manufactures and markets analog, mixed-signal, and audio DSP integrated circuits (ICs). The company's chips are used in a wide range of industrial and consumer markets including portable and non-portable media players, smartphones, tablets, home-theater receivers, automotive entertainment systems, televisions, docking stations, as well as wearables which includes, smart watches, action cameras, smart bands and VR headsets. Apart from this, its mixed-signal converter chips are used in energy-related applications such as digital utility meter and LED controllers for the incandescent light-bulb replacement market. The company has two reportable segments: Audio and High-Performance Mixed-Signal.
